How you'll make an impact in this role
Guarantee patient safety by meticulously decontaminating and sterilizing surgical instruments according to the highest clinical standards and manufacturer guidelines.
Lead the quality control process by inspecting and assembling complex instrument sets, ensuring every tool is functional, complete, and ready for the surgeon’s hand.
Optimize surgical workflows by maintaining precise inventory levels and preparing accurate case carts, ensuring the operating team has exactly what they need when they need it.
Validate the integrity of sterilization equipment through rigorous monitoring and testing, providing the team with total confidence in the sterility of every container and device.
Support a culture of excellence by performing peer audits and quality assurance checks, fostering a collaborative environment dedicated to zero-error clinical outcomes.
